Split Models to max 64 000 K faces automatically?

Hi, if i export some model to *.3ds format, theres a limit to max 64 000 faces (tris?) per model, sometimes i have a more complex model with different parts that have more than this, splitting the models (via detach) manually so each separate part of the model has less then 64 000 faces takes quite a time, is there a script please that can check the scene and automatically separate (detach group of faces)of the object so that each new part has less than 64 000 faces?
Is there something like this already existing please (i didnt come acros something like this)?

Is it important to be *.3ds file extension? I ask because this format is very old. As alternitive you can check first if object have some elements and separate by elements if not then check number of faces and then detach by faces less then 64K of course.
